Delaying impact player entry point is a strategy as per Ashwin. Basically getting certain guys early sometimes becomes counter productive. lol Is he talking about Kohli,  Kela?

Ashwin is not overly against removal of impact rule.  He believes bowlers have to get better. As per Ashwin in next few years all 11 players will be swinging from the hip.
